Easy Anti-Cheat Implementation
Epic has made Easy Anti-Cheat (EAC) a requirement for online play in Rocket League, aiming to combat issues like win trading bots that plagued high-ranking matches. While many players might not experience significant changes, this move is a major shift for the game's competitive landscape. EAC is expected to enhance fairness, as expressed by community member tbrockl337, who stated, "It completely cleared out the win trading bots." This shift marks a new chapter in the game's ongoing evolution.
The End of BakkesMod
With the introduction of EAC, the beloved BakkesMod will no longer function on game versions released on April 28th and later. BakkesMod has been a staple for many players, offering over 800 community-submitted plugins and boasting a daily user base of over 750,000. Creator Bakkes reflected on the mod's impact, saying, "It is absolutely incredible to see how well liked and commonly used BakkesMod is to this day." However, he noted that the arrival of EAC feels like the right time to conclude the project.
Community Reactions and Concerns
The announcement of EAC has stirred mixed emotions within the community. While some players express sadness over BakkesMod's end, others have voiced concerns about potential performance issues linked to EAC. Reports indicate a small spike in negative reviews, although many players, including those who tested the game post-update, have reported no noticeable performance degradation. The community reaction leans towards disappointment, with sentiments that Psyonix and Epic could have better integrated some of BakkesMod's best features into the base game.
